High resolution proton scattering from 42Ca

Description
Differential cross sections were measured for 42Ca(p,p) at four angles between Esub(p)=1.2 and 3.0 MeV, with an overall energy resolution of 325 eV. Spins, parities and proton widths were extracted for 170 resonances. Two analogue states were identified and spectroscopic factors determined. The nearest neighbor spacing distributions were analyzed. Proton strength functions were determined for 1/2+, 1/2- and 3/2- resonances. (Auth.)
